Universal Studios Japan

Opening Date: March 31st 2001
Pokémon First Introduction Date: March 1st 2023
Location: Konohana-ku, Osaka, Japan

Universal Studios Japan is one of several Universal themed theme parks, and the only one that is in Japan. This park runs a variety of different rides and lands based on various franchises, including being the inaugural home for Super Nintendo World, the first Nintendo theme park

No Limit Summer Splash Parade

Duration: July 3rd 2024 - September 1st 2024

The No Limit! Summer Splash Parade is a daily parade that ran through the summer of 2024 as part of the annual Splash season. This parade is an alteration of the No Limit parade and has the dancers and floats spray water around to cool visitors to the park. It has multiple new floats including a Gyarados one to fit the water motif

Pokémon Jumpin' Halloween Party

Duration: September 6th 2023 - November 5th 2023

The Pokémon Halloween show is the first daytime show focused on Pokémon and features a show starring DJ Pikachu and DJ Gengar to provide music and visuals you can move and dance to.

Throughout the duration of the event, new food was also available at areas throughout the park

No Limit Parade

Duration: March 1st 2023 - April 6th 2024

The No Limit! Parade is a daily parade that ran through 2023 in the main USJ park. This parade features characters from a variety of franchises including Super Mario and Pokémon.

In the parade, there is a Pokémon float with various dancers, the dancers hold puppets of various Pokémon: Grookey, Oricorio, Spinda, Squirtle and Bulbasaur while a Pikachu mascot is on the float. The float also features a massive Charizard which blows steam out of its mouth. Following the float are some dancers holding up balloon Lugia & Ho-Oh to fly around to the music.

To tie in with this, various Pokémon merchandise was put on sale including keyrings, badges and T-Shirts. Several pieces of Pokémon related food were also available including a Squirtle Vanilla Churro, a Bulbasaur Melon Soda drink with sipper and a Pikachu Pizza Bun.
